what is 'urea'?
Definition for urea
Urea is an organic compound with the chemical formula ( N H 2 ) 2 C O .
Urea is also known by the International Nonproprietary Name (rINN) carbamide , as established by the World Health Organization .
more
Urea is an organic compound with the chemical formula ( N H 2 ) 2 C O .
Urea is also known by the International Nonproprietary Name (rINN) carbamide , as established by the World Health Organization . For example, the medicinal compound hydroxyurea (old British Approved Name) is now hydroxycarbamide . Other names include carbamide resin , isourea , carbonyl diamide , and carbonyldiamine .
